Warning Signs You Need Thermal Imaging Leak Detection
Catching the signs of a leak early on can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ent costly water damage. Don't ignore these warning signs, they're your home's way of telling you something's amiss. Our team is here to help you identify and fix the issue before it's too late.
Musty Odors That Won't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your home can be a sign of hidden moisture, which may show a leak. Don't ignore these smells, they can be a precursor to more serious problems.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Discoloration or water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a leak. Don't assume it's just a minor issue, it could be a symptom of a larger problem.
Unexplained Water Bills
Unexpected spikes in your water bills can be a sign of a hidden leak. Don't ignore these increases, they can add up quickly and cause significant financial strain.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age, which may show a leak. Don't ignore these signs, they can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ards.
Musty Smells in Your Attic or Basement
Musty smells in your attic or basement can be a sign of hidden moisture, which may show a leak. Don't ignore these smells, they can be a precursor to more serious problems.
Unexplained Noises at Night
Unexplained noises at night, such as dripping or running water, can be a sign of a leak. Don't ignore these sounds, they can be a symptom of a larger problem.
